使用npx快速安装taotokencli并通过交互菜单配置开发环境
🚀 告别海外账号与网络限制!稳定直连全球优质大模型,限时半价接入中。 👉 点击领取海量免费额度
使用npx快速安装taotokencli并通过交互菜单配置开发环境
基础教程类,指导开发者使用npx命令运行taotokencli工具,通过其交互式菜单选择常用开发工具如python的openai库或claude code,并一键写入对应的api密钥与聚合端点配置,简化多环境初始化流程。
在接入多个大模型服务时,开发者通常需要为不同的工具和项目重复配置API密钥、模型ID和端点地址。这个过程繁琐且容易出错,尤其是当不同工具对API端点的格式要求不一致时。Taotoken CLI工具(@taotoken/taotoken)提供了一个统一的交互式菜单,能够帮助开发者快速完成常用开发环境的初始化配置。
1. 安装与启动Taotoken CLI
Taotoken CLI是一个Node.js包,你可以通过npm全局安装它,也可以直接使用npx命令运行,无需永久安装。对于希望快速体验或临时配置的用户,推荐使用npx方式。
打开你的终端(命令行工具),输入以下命令即可启动CLI:
npx @taotoken/taotoken首次运行时会下载必要的包文件,稍等片刻后,你将看到一个交互式菜单界面。如果你计划频繁使用此工具,也可以选择全局安装,这样以后直接输入taotoken命令即可启动。全局安装命令为:
npm install -g @taotoken/taotoken安装完成后,同样在终端输入taotoken启动程序。
2. 通过交互菜单选择配置工具
启动CLI后,你会看到一个清晰的中文菜单,列出了当前支持配置的几种常用开发工具。菜单选项通常包括配置OpenAI兼容的Python/Node.js环境、配置Claude Code、配置OpenClaw以及配置Hermes Agent等。
使用键盘的上下方向键可以在不同选项间移动,按回车键确认选择。例如,如果你主要使用Python的openai库进行开发,就选择对应的OpenAI SDK配置选项。如果你使用Claude Code进行代码生成和对话,则选择Claude Code配置选项。
这个菜单设计的核心目的是让你无需记忆复杂的命令参数,通过直观的选择就能进入对应工具的配置流程。选择后,CLI会引导你完成后续的必要信息填写。
3. 填写配置信息并一键写入
选择目标工具后,CLI会以交互式提问的方式,引导你输入必要的配置信息。整个过程通常是线性的,你只需要根据提示一步步操作。
首先,系统会提示你输入在Taotoken平台获取的API Key。你需要提前登录Taotoken控制台,在API密钥管理页面创建一个新的密钥。将密钥复制并粘贴到终端的提示符后。
接下来,CLI会提示你输入或选择要使用的模型ID。你可以直接在Taotoken平台的模型广场查看所有可用模型及其对应的ID。输入模型ID后,CLI会自动为你拼接正确的聚合端点地址。
关键点:不同工具所需的Base URL格式不同,CLI会根据你选择的工具自动处理,这是其核心便利性所在。
- 对于OpenAI兼容的SDK(如Python的
openai库),CLI会配置base_url为https://taotoken.net/api。 - 对于Claude Code(使用Anthropic兼容协议),CLI会配置
ANTHROPIC_BASE_URL为https://taotoken.net/api(注意末尾没有/v1)。
所有信息填写完毕后,CLI会询问确认,并将配置一键写入到对应工具的默认配置文件中。例如,配置OpenAI SDK可能会写入到你的环境变量或本地配置文件;配置Claude Code则会修改其settings.json文件。
4. 验证配置与开始使用
配置写入完成后,CLI通常会给出成功提示,并显示配置写入的路径。为了确保配置生效,建议你进行简单的验证。
如果你配置的是Python环境,可以创建一个简单的测试脚本:
from openai import OpenAI client = OpenAI() # 默认会读取CLI配置的环境变量或配置文件 try: completion = client.chat.completions.create( model="gpt-4o-mini", # 使用你配置的模型ID messages=[{"role": "user", "content": "Hello, world"}], ) print("配置成功!回复:", completion.choices[0].message.content) except Exception as e: print("配置测试失败:", e)如果配置的是Claude Code,你可以重新启动Claude Code客户端,检查设置中是否已正确显示Taotoken的端点和模型。
通过以上步骤,你无需手动编辑复杂的配置文件或环境变量,也无需担心记错端点地址的格式差异,就完成了开发环境的快速初始化。当你需要切换模型或为另一个工具配置时,只需重新运行npx @taotoken/taotoken,选择新的目标即可。
完成配置后,你可以立即开始使用聚合后的模型服务进行开发。更多关于模型选择、用量查看等高级功能,请参考Taotoken平台的官方文档。
🚀 告别海外账号与网络限制!稳定直连全球优质大模型,限时半价接入中。 👉 点击领取海量免费额度
